On Wed, 29 Sep 2004, Darcy Buskermolen wrote:

> On September 29, 2004 11:09 am, Marc G. Fournier wrote:
>> On Wed, 29 Sep 2004, Darcy Buskermolen wrote:
> ----8<----[snip]
> > jails are not the problem ... the problem is the file system we are using
>> to share applications ... but, yes, if we could put a dedicated box in
>> place, we could very easily eliminate the use of the file system ... we
>> have never had a jail related crash on those servers, they have always
>> come down to the file system itself ...
>
> Poor use of terminlogy on my part, but the net effect is the same, the FS is
> being used to facilitate the jail, take away the jail, take away the need of
> the stacked FS.

Actuallym, not true ... the FS is used to reduce the overall amount of
disk space required, since ~90% of the jail is redundant ... when I can
get a dedicated server in place, and only have the 10 or so VMs running on
it, then disk space is no longer an issue, so I can easily get rid of the
FS component ... that would get rid of the crashes ...
